Mohammed Bin Rashid Library Welcomes a Delegation from Mohammed Bin Rashid Space Centre
Last Update: Friday, September 16, 2022 : 15:17 (+4GMT)
Dubai, UAE; September 16, 2022: The Mohammed Bin Rashid Library (MBRL) received a delegation from the Mohammed Bin Rashid Space Centre (MBRSC), led by H.E. Eng. Salem Al Marri, MBRSC Director General, to learn about the specialised and unique services the library offers to visitors, and view its collection of space-related books and references. The visit also aimed to discuss ways to enhance cooperation, in order to familiarise the younger generations with the UAE's historical achievements in this pioneering and vital sector.

During the visit, the delegation got acquainted with MBRL’s various facilities, services, and libraries, along with a tour through the UAE photography exhibition, a unique journey that recounts the UAE’s cultural, political, and social development over the past fifty years. The delegation also visited the Treasures of the Library exhibition, which displays an impressive collection of rare and old books, atlases, and manuscripts, some of which dating back to the 13th century. The visit included a briefing on the Library's dedicated spaces for meetings, and organizing cultural and artistic festivals, and hosting local and international film screenings, theatre performances and music concerts.
Moreover, MBRL staff detailed members of the visiting delegation on the Library’s vision in terms of hosting activities and its annual programme of events, as well as its adoption of the latest artificial intelligence and library technologies available worldwide. Such technologies feature an electronic retrieval system, self-service booths, a book digitisation lab, smart robots to answer visitors' inquiries, along with implementing AR, VR, and other advanced technologies.

At the conclusion of the visit, the delegation presented MBRL a range of its valuable publications, including one in Braille system, which sheds light on the Emirates Mars Mission (The Hope probe), the Arab world's first mission to another planet. Mohammed Bin Rashid Library, built over more than 500,000 sq. ft. including land and floor spaces, is one of the most remarkable buildings in the Middle East, with an architectural concept inspired by "The Rehl"- the traditional X-shaped lectern used across the Islamic world. The Library is one of the most technologically-advanced libraries in the world, utilising artificial intelligence technologies (AI), augmented reality (AR), holograms, and smart robots.
